Switching Sides!
French fries are a traditional side dish for for hamburgers,
sandwiches, steak, just about anything!
Switch to one of these recipes to change things up!
These Steak House Fries are oven roasted with olive oil
and garnished with a sprinkle of garlic and parsley
They are “planks” cut from russet potatoes,
skin on, which makes them tastier and more nutritious
Baked Waffle Fries are another yummy alternative
Skin on russet potatoes are cut in half
and then the insides are cut deeply into small squares or diamonds

Instead of ketchup,
serve a little sour cream and green onions for dipping

Italian Fries are made with new potatoes

And then there are these fries~
they are made with a secret step…
I have been told they are the Best French Fries Ever!

Potato Peel Fries are russet potatoes sliced thin vertically
with their nutritious skin on

Go in Circles with fries that are a thin version of traditional curly fries
They are lighter than heavy thick fries
